Chapter 5 Configure the Module in a GuardLogix Controller System
Configure Safety 
Connections
Follow these steps to configure the module’s safety input connection.
1. From the Module Properties dialog box, click the Safety tab.
2. Click Advanced to open the Advanced Connection Reaction Time Limit 
Configuration dialog box.
a. In the Requested Packet Interval (RPI) field, enter the input 
connection RPI to support your application (between 6 and 500 ms).
The smallest input RPI allowed is 6 ms. Selecting small RPIs consumes 
network bandwidth and may cause nuisance trips because other devices 
cannot get access to the network.
As an example, a safety input module with only E-stop switches 
connected may generally work well with settings of 50…100 ms. An 
input module with a light curtain guarding a hazard may need the 
fastest response possible. Selecting appropriate RPIs results in a system 
with maximum (best) performance.
